I think it's more like "Arco" or "Shell." As if each distributor of gasoline put in an additive that made it useable on only a certain brand of car.
You can go to any gas station and get regular, unleaded, premium or diesel, and the one you need will work in your car. But imagine that the Amazon gas only works in Fords, and the B&N gas only works in Chevies, and the Borders gas only works in BMWs...unless you go to the independent station whose gas works in all cars because it doesn't contain that additive, DRMosol. The publishing/distributing industry is just insane, IMO. |
